RAM 1GB 2Rx16 PC2-6400S-666-12-A3 explained

1GB 2Rx16 PC2-6400S-666-12-A3 — Memory Module Overview This is a DDR2 laptop memory module with a capacity of 1GB. It uses a 200-pin SO-DIMM interface, runs at 800MHz, and falls under the PC2-6400 specification. Core Technical Specifications · Capacity: 1GB…
